Activity Data Samples
Top measurements by pChEMBL value
| Target | Type | Rel. | Value | Units | pChEMBL | Assay | PubMed |
|---|---|---|---|---|---|---|---|
| Unchecked | Ki | = | 14.0 | nM | 7.85 | In vitro binding affinity for Dopamine receptor D1 | 15689153 |
| Unchecked | Ki | = | 30.0 | nM | 7.52 | In vitro binding affinity for Dopamine receptor D5 | 15689153 |
| Unchecked | Ki | = | 137.0 | nM | 6.86 | In vitro binding affinity for 5-HT transporter | 15689153 |
| Unchecked | Ki | = | 154.0 | nM | 6.81 | In vitro binding affinity for Alpha-2a adrenergic receptor | 15689153 |
| Unchecked | Ki | = | 3550.0 | nM | 5.45 | In vitro binding affinity for Dopamine receptor D2 | 15689153 |
| Unchecked | Ki | = | 10000.0 | nM | 5.0 | In vitro binding affinity for Dopamine receptor D4 | 15689153 |
